Runbook: Fareline ticket-pricing experiment. New folks — before touching the experiment config, check that the holdout group is still receiving baseline prices; the dashboard's "control drift" panel should read under 1%. If it doesn't, pause the experiment via the flag service and notify the pricing lead. Always log your change against the experiment's current build, recorded below.

trace token, fafog-kageg: htk4_98e6

## FareForge Environments

FareForge evaluates shipping-fee rules in three environments: sandbox, staging, and prod. Plugin authors must target sandbox first; rules promote automatically after validation. Staging mirrors prod rule sets nightly. Do not hardcode endpoints — resolve them per environment. The sandbox evaluation environment uses the following configuration values.

service settings:
[casax]
port = 6379
team = rusir
host = casax.zemvarhq.corp
region = outer-4
access_code = ac_9808ce
timeout_ms = 1500

Subject: DR drill for Gallerytone plugins — action needed

Hello plugin authors,

Next Thursday we run a disaster-recovery drill for the Gallerytone audio-guide platform. During the drill, the Hallowmere plugin registry will fail over to the standby region and plugin uploads will pause for roughly two hours. To re-authenticate your publishing tools against the standby registry during the window, use the recovery passphrase provided below.

vault phrase of hawif-bahof = novvan-belius-istael-fenvan-holdor-druox-eliath

Subject: Gross-Margin Review — Q3

Team,

Q3 gross margin on the Fenwick line slipped to 41%, down four points, driven by freight and a one-off rework at the Branholm site. Corrective pricing goes live next month; finance to restate the forecast by Friday. Full detail at Tuesday's session. The relevant planning note is appended below.

confidential, kagep-kahof: Druokax Systems plans to lower the Ulaath list price by 53 percent in March.